Let it Flow
Friend, neighbor, and contractor Jim Shaw installed a hot water line out the rink-side of my house. I have an old boarded up window that sits in the foundation wall and it's relatively hidden but in an ideal location. It's a straight line from the faucet to the rink and I can't wait to use it for flooding purposes.
Only bad things happen fast when owning a backyard rink. Building, maintaining, and repairing a rink takes time, patience, and a willingness to accept what Mother Nature gives you - Scott
